组件通用属性
标题
即组件名称,拖入画布后,组件的默认名称为组件的类型名,如单行文本,用户可根据业务需求更改组件的标题,帮助表单填报人员更好的识别需要填报的内容。
标题为空时,默认只有一个输入框:
字段名
字段存入数据库的唯一标识,不支持修改。
默认值
指用户访问表单时,该字段默认显示的内容,默认值的配置支持自定义默认值、快捷变量、函数计算。
- 自定义默认值
设置一个固定的默认值,在表单填写时会默认展示该数据,用户在填报表单时可清除默认值重新录入数据。
配置完成后,点击「预览」可以查看配置的效果:
- 快捷变量
为方便用户配置,我们将一些组件常用的默认值抽象出来,方便用户进行配置。对于日期时间组件,在配置组件默认值时,可以选择配置快捷变量,如今天、明天、昨天、本月初。
配置完成后,点击「预览」可以查看配置的效果:
- 函数计算
当表单内某一字段的默认值需要通过使用表单内字段进行函数计算时,可通过配置函数计算来实现,如配置总价字段的默认值为单价*数量。在编辑函数计算时,我们会打开函数编辑面板,可以在此选择所需要进行计算的字段和函数公式。
配置完成后,点击「预览」可以查看配置的效果:
占位提示
占位提示可以用来提醒表单填报者该字段需要录入的内容,该信息仅用于提示,不会影响表单字段的值。如下,提示用户输入电话号码:
配置完成后,可预览表单:
标题提示
标题提示可用来向用户介绍该字段或提示用户该字段在表单中的作用(标题提示默认是关闭状态),配置后预览如下:
配置标题提示时,支持配置如下内容:
- 提示标题:提示内容的标题;
- 内容:提示的具体内容;
- 弹出位置:提示弹出的位置;
- 图标:提示图标;
- 触发方式:触发提示内容的方式;
控件提示
与标题提示一样,控件提示也是发挥组件的解释说明作用(控件提示默认是关闭状态),具体可参考:标题提示。配置后预览如下:
描述
编辑字段的描述信息,用于提示字段的功能、范围、填写注意事项等。
组件样式
配置组件在表单中的布局,如:
- 标题位置:默认会继承表单整体配置,也可自行配置组件局部布局。
- 宽度:组件在表单中的宽度占比,每个组件在拖入表单时都有一个默认的宽度,用户也可以自行调整宽度。
配置完成后,可直接预览表单:
状态
配置组件的显隐或是否可编辑状态,可通过条件进行控制。
- 可见:在表单填写时,可见,可编辑。
- 隐藏:在表单填写时,不可见。
- 静态展示:在表单填写时,可见,不可编辑,在表单中不会展示字段属性。
- 禁用:在表单填写时,可见,不可编辑,在表单中会展示字段属性。
若字段的状态需要通过一定的条件进行控制,可以添加前置条件,如,配置电话字段的显隐条件为,姓名字段为对应值时,才显示电话字段:
校验
用于表单填报时对表单内字段的一些校验。用户可以配置「校验规则」以及校验失败时的「错误提示」(若未配置则使用系统默认提示)
- 必填
当表单填报人未填写该字段时,则在提交表单时会提示填报人该字段为必填项,需要填写方可提交表单。
- 与指定值相同
字段填写值需与配置的值内容相同。
- 与指定字段相同
可指定该字段与表单内某一字段的值相同。
- 特殊属性校验
- 对于电话、邮箱组件,会校验输入的内容是否满足电话或邮箱的规范。
- 对于文本类组件,如单行文本、多行文本,可添加多种校验类型,如身份证校验等
清除器
开启/关闭组件的清除器,默认是关闭的。开启后,用户在填写表单时可一键清空组件输入框内所输入的内容。
配置完成后,预览如下:
计数器
开启/关闭组件的计数器,默认是关闭的。可以统计并查看输入框内输入的文本数量(不影响组件内容录入)
配置完成后,预览如下: